Trident Technical College Youth Apprenticeship Program
The Trident Technical College Youth Apprenticeship Program is a two-year “learn and earn” model designed to prepare students for high-demand careers while still in school. The program combines:
-
Paid, on-the-job training with participating employers
-
College-level classroom instruction at Trident Technical College
-
Tuition-free coursework for students hired by approved companies
This program is open to rising high school juniors, seniors, and graduating seniors across the Charleston-area region who are seeking real-world career training alongside their education.
HVAC Technician Pathway
Markel completed the HVAC Technician apprenticeship pathway, which focuses on building practical, job-ready technical skills. The program requires apprentices to work a minimum of three full days per week, allowing them to gain meaningful hands-on experience in the field while learning directly from experienced professionals.
Upon completion of the two-year program, apprentices earn:
-
Two years of paid work experience and professional mentoring
-
One year of college credit from Trident Technical College at no cost
-
A nationally recognized credential from the U.S. Department of Labor
-
Marketable, career-ready HVAC skills

About Cullum Mechanical
Founded in 1972 by Furman Cullum in Charleston, South Carolina, Cullum Mechanical Construction, Inc. grew steadily across the state before expanding into two specialized subsidiaries—Cullum Constructors, Inc. and Cullum Services, Inc.—in 1999. These companies quickly established themselves as leaders in mechanical contracting, construction, and HVAC services throughout the Southeast. In 2023, Cullum Mechanical, LLC was formed to carry the company’s legacy forward, ensuring continued growth, innovation, and leadership in the industry.
